[4:14pm] paveljanik: BTW - what is the status of scrollbar?
[4:15pm] ericb2: I just wanted to talk about my current work
[4:15pm] ericb2: since Apple Expo, I had not too much time, but since yesterday, i think I have found what we have to do, not yet what exactly do
[4:17pm] ericb2: for aliscafo the code is in vcl/source/control/scrbar.cxx
[4:17pm] ericb2: the problem is : vcl controls are not located like native controls ( Btn1 and Butn2 )
[4:17pm] ericb2: I'm preparing a complete description, because I think it's better to ask Philip Lohmann
[4:18pm] ericb2: vcl/source/control/scrbar.cxx is in core (common part), and introduce MACOSX ifdefs is not correct
[4:18pm] ericb2: I'd vote for create a new type of button, only used on MACOSX
[4:19pm] ericb2: e.g. deactivate Btn1 and replace it with new Btn3, but pl will confirm
[4:21pm] oulipo left the chat room.
[4:21pm] ericb2: code relative to other controls is in the same dir too, and we have a lot of informations about how to implement to one not yet implemented
[4:21pm] paveljanik: ericb2: I think it would be better to first describe what you have found and send it to the list and cc to Stephan and PL, yes.
[4:22pm] ericb2: paveljanik: yes, sure. I have some screenshots to complete the description.
[4:22pm] paveljanik: good
[4:23pm] ericb2: paveljanik: the problem is, it seems to be very difficult to translate a control without break a lot of things. My first try gave me an ill scrollbar
[4:24pm] aliscafo: ericb2: why do we need to do that?
[4:25pm] ericb2: aliscafo: when you want to move from right to left, you must click on left, and the arrow is on right (just beside the other one)
[4:25pm] ericb2: aliscafo: same for vertical scrollbar
[4:26pm] ericb2: aliscafo: aqua control does use twice arrows
[4:26pm] aliscafo: ericb2: ok but that would be solved if we knew how to implement properly the getNativeControlRegion function
[4:27pm] paveljanik: yes.
[4:27pm] ericb2: aliscafo: IMHO, this is the same problem : we define RectButn1 and RectButn2, and values are .. not what we expect
[4:27pm] ybart: Mac OS X can also be configured to display two set of arrows for each slider...
[4:27pm] aliscafo: ericb2: there is a way to know what the current setting in terms of arrows is, according to the result we can redraw the right/up arrow
[4:28pm] aliscafo: ericb2: ok let me see
[4:28pm] ericb2: aliscafo: RectButn1 ( or Region don't remember exactly) is the wrong one
[4:28pm] ericb2: aliscafo: of course, you are right
[4:29pm] paveljanik: I think we can wait for Eric's description and discuss on the list...
[4:29pm] aliscafo: ericb2: we just need to look closer at the gtk implementation and i think we can find the solution
[4:29pm] aliscafo: paveljanik: yes we can talk about it later ericb2 if you want
[4:29pm] ericb2: aliscafo: a good example of getNativeControlRegion() does already exist in unx part
[4:30pm] ericb2: aliscafo: in vcl/unx/gtk/gdi/salnativewidgets.cxx
[4:30pm] ericb2: aliscafo: sorry : in vcl/unx/gtk/gdi/salnativewidgets-gtk.cxx
[4:30pm] aliscafo: ericb2: yup i know
[4:31pm] aliscafo: ericb2: i told you about it
